LCC 2009 Retreat “Transformation”

From August 14-16th, we had our annual church retreat. This year it was held at Deer Creek Christian Camp in Bailey, Colorado. We flew in a close friend and ministry colleague, Dr. James Choung, the national director of Asian American Ministries with InterVarsity Christian Fellowship. He’s also the author of True Story: A Christianity Worth Believing In (InterVarsity Press, 2008).

James brought the book of Genesis to life as he shared about God’s plan to redeem all of creation. It was one of the first times that our church members heard that God created humans that were “very good” in his eyes. It was a refreshing and thought-provoking series of sermons. God truly blessed the congregation that weekend. I saw many people raising their hands to the Lord in praise and worship. People were sharing intimate and even painful moments from their past with each other in small groups. Everyone was praying for each other. God was truly evident in that place. My prayer is that the fire will not cease as time goes on.

Thanks James for bringing the gospel with conviction, clarity, and charisma.
